About the Role:
  • Crafting Red Team engagement plans based on current threat actors and landscape to emulate real world scenarios.
  • Collaborating with applicable product owners and engineers on timelines, scope, and necessary support
  • Executing Red Team operations while working with product owners, threat detection engineers, and SOC/CIRT to provide meaningful output that can be actioned into security hardening efforts and improved security processes to reduce alert, investigation, and remediation timelines.
  • Writing and communicating detailed reports with findings and recommended follow-on actions.
  • Continuous validation testing in collaboration with threat detection engineers ensuring past operations led to overall increased security posture.


About You:
  • 5+ years with hands-on Red Teaming
  • B.S. in Computer Science or related field
  • OSCP or related cert (such as Red Team Ops I/II)
  • Considered an expert in at least one domain, such as: AWS/Azure/Google Cloud Platform Cloud, Windows AD, EDR evasion, endpoint privilege escalation techniques, etc
  • Ability to code using Python, Golang, C/C++
  • Ability to document and communicate findings
  • Experience with Atomic Red or other automated attack simulation tools
  • Deep knowledge of networking stack


Ways to stand out:
  • Public speaking engagements
  • Published blogs/writeup examples - Advanced certs (OSED, etc.)
  • Post-graduate degree in Computer Science or related field
  • Experience testing AI/ML systems, including LLMs
  • Reverse engineering experience
  • Familiarity with building shellcode (including bypassing DEP and ASLR)
  • Experience with advanced EDR evasion techniques - Knowledge of Threat Detection tools and techniques
  • Expertise in Operating Systems (e.g., how filesystems work, inter-process communication, system calls, etc.)
